Carbon footprinting

J&G can undertake carbon footprinting of a particular facility, business, building, process or product. Our approach follows accepted international standards for Environmental Management Systems (ISO 14001:2004) and carbon footprinting (Greenhouse Gases Protocol, ISO14064:2006 and PAS 2050)

Environmental Footprinting

The measurement of an environmental footprint goes beyond that of a carbon footprint in that it includes the potential impacts of an organization’s activities in terms of water and waste, thereby establishing a holistic picture of the environmental impact.
